Summary

The DHS CWMD Personal Radiation Detector (PRD) Maritime Variant RFI is a request for information aimed at gathering insights on commercially available Personal Radiation Detectors that can detect gamma and neutron radiation. This RFI is part of the Department of Homeland Security's efforts to enhance its capabilities in detecting unauthorized radiological materials and improving the safety of maritime operations. Contractors with expertise in radiation detection technology, particularly those offering Commercial Off-The-Shelf (COTS) solutions, are encouraged to respond. The RFI seeks detailed technical descriptions of devices, including their networking and data streaming capabilities, as well as compliance with specific performance requirements outlined in the attached documentation. This opportunity is particularly relevant for small businesses, including those classified as 8(a), Historically Underutilized Business Zone, or Service Disabled Veteran Owned Small Businesses, that can meet the outlined specifications.
